本文目录导读:
随着互联网技术的飞速发展,企业对服务器性能和稳定性要求越来越高,在多服务器环境下,如何合理分配负载,提高资源利用率,确保系统稳定运行,成为了企业关注的焦点,负载均衡系统作为一种重要的技术手段,在服务器配置中扮演着至关重要的角色,本文将从负载均衡系统的概念、配置方法及应用场景等方面进行深入探讨。
负载均衡系统概述
1、概念
图片来源于网络,如有侵权联系删除
负载均衡系统是指将多个服务器资源进行整合,通过合理分配负载,实现资源共享、提高系统性能和稳定性的一种技术手段,它可以将请求分发到不同的服务器上,确保每台服务器都能充分利用其性能,从而提高整体系统的吞吐量和稳定性。
2、分类
根据不同的负载均衡算法,负载均衡系统可分为以下几类:
(1)轮询算法:将请求均匀地分配到各个服务器上,适用于服务器性能相近的场景。
(2)最少连接算法:根据服务器当前连接数进行分配,适用于连接数较多的场景。
(3)IP哈希算法:根据客户端IP地址进行分配,适用于需要会话保持的场景。
(4)最小响应时间算法:根据服务器响应时间进行分配,适用于对响应速度有较高要求的场景。
负载均衡服务器配置
1、硬件配置
(1)服务器:选择性能稳定、扩展性好的服务器,如Intel Xeon系列处理器、DDR4内存等。
图片来源于网络,如有侵权联系删除
(2)网络设备:选用高速交换机、防火墙等网络设备,确保网络带宽和安全性。
2、软件配置
(1)操作系统:选择稳定、易管理的操作系统,如Linux、Windows Server等。
(2)负载均衡软件:根据实际需求选择合适的负载均衡软件,如LVS、HAProxy、Nginx等。
(3)配置文件:根据服务器性能、网络环境等因素,对负载均衡软件进行配置,以下以LVS为例,介绍LVS的配置方法。
(1)安装LVS
在Linux服务器上,使用以下命令安装LVS:
yum install ipvsadm
(2)配置LVS
① 创建虚拟IP(VIP)
图片来源于网络,如有侵权联系删除
ipvsadm -A -t 192.168.1.10:80 -g
② 创建真实服务器IP(RIP)
ipvsadm -a -t 192.168.1.10:80 -r 192.168.1.11:80 -m ipvsadm -a -t 192.168.1.10:80 -r 192.168.1.12:80 -m
③ 查看LVS配置
ipvsadm -L
负载均衡系统应用场景
1、网站集群:将多个服务器组成网站集群,实现高可用性和高性能。
2、数据库集群:将多个数据库服务器组成数据库集群,提高数据访问速度和稳定性。
3、应用服务器集群:将多个应用服务器组成应用服务器集群,提高系统吞吐量和稳定性。
4、CDN加速:利用负载均衡系统,将请求分发到不同地理位置的服务器上,提高访问速度。
负载均衡系统在服务器配置中具有重要作用,能够提高资源利用率、保证系统稳定运行,通过合理配置负载均衡服务器,企业可以构建高效、可靠的服务器集群,满足日益增长的业务需求,在实际应用中,应根据业务场景和需求,选择合适的负载均衡算法和配置方法,以确保系统性能和稳定性。
标签: #负载均衡系统在服务器上什么意思
评论列表